Middle School Teacher, Except Special and Career/Technical Education Salary in Topeka, Kansas

The annual salary statistics of middle school teachers, except special and career/technical education in Topeka, Kansas is shown in Table 1. The wage data of middle school teachers, except special and career/technical education in Topeka is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].

Table 1. Annual Salary of Middle School Teachers, Except Special and Career/Technical Education in Topeka, Kansas

Percentile BracketAverage Annual Salary
10th Percentile Wage
$47,040
25th Percentile Wage
$48,040
50th Percentile Wage
$61,180
75th Percentile Wage
$74,140
90th Percentile Wage
$77,980

Table 1 shows the average annual salary for middle school teachers, except special and career/technical education in Topeka, Kansas in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$77,980.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$61,180.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$47,040.
